Abstract

Geographically Indonesia is a country that has many islands which make it has a great water resources. Economically Indonesia is developing country. Cross flow hidro turbine is small electrical powerplant that with simple form and easy to make. This writing is about Cross flow hidro turbine design, based on experimental study that was done by author and others, specifically stressed on the design and performance, where simple turbine result in optimal power. Model size and turbine efficiency in some study mentioned above are presented. Equation for runner diameter and vane radius also described. On this turbine it was predicted that the sentrifugal force will affect the turbine power. This prediction will be interesting to further study
